Regular maintenance can assist avoid the requirement for frequent repairs. Here are some pointers:
Regular Cleaning: Clean the tracks and rollers at least every couple of months.Lubrication: Apply a silicone-based lube to the tracks and rollers to guarantee smooth motion.Examine Weather Stripping: Inspect and change weather condition stripping as needed to preserve energy effectiveness.Tighten Hardware: Periodically check screws and fittings to make sure whatever is firmly secured.FAQ: Sliding Door RepairQ1: How often should I clean my sliding door tracks?
Cleaning your sliding door tracks every 3 to six months is ideal, or sooner if you notice debris build-up.
Q2: Can I replace the glass myself?
If you're comfortable and have the right tools, you can change the glass. However, working with a professional might be much safer for bigger panes or complex doors.
Q3: What kind of lubricant is best for sliding doors?
A silicone-based lubricant is recommended since it doesn't bring in dirt and securely keeps the tracks and rollers moving efficiently.
Q4: My sliding door is still challenging to operate after cleansing. What should I do?
Misalignment or harmed rollers might need attention. If you've cleaned up and the door is still tough to run, consider checking the rollers or having a professional assess the alignment.
Q5: Are there any signs that indicate I should change my sliding door?
Indications consist of considerable physical damage to the door, relentless functional problems after repairs, or damaged glass. If repair costs exceed replacement, it's time to think about a brand-new door.
